对象存储基本用法(Bucket / Object / 常用操作)

对象存储的用法在各厂商间高度同构:核心概念(bucket、object、key)一致, 常用操作(列桶、建桶、列对象、上传、下载、签名 URL、删除)一一对应。 本文提炼通用用法;厂商差异见 供应商对比(Vendors), 签名 URL 原理见 签名 URL(Signed URL)

核心概念

Bucket(桶)

  • 对象存储的顶层命名空间,容纳一组对象
  • 名称在同一厂商内全局唯一(不同厂商之间可以重名)
  • 默认私有(private):匿名无法读取;公开桶(public)才可无鉴权访问
  • 删除约束:空桶才能删除,非空桶删除会失败 —— 先删对象再删桶

Object(对象)与 Key

  • 对象 = Key + 数据(Data)+ 元数据(Metadata,如 Content-Type)
  • Key 是完整路径(如 demo/r2-client/hello.txt);对象存储里没有真正的 目录 / 文件夹 —— "目录"只是 Key 的前缀约定(prefix),列对象时按前缀 过滤即可实现"列目录"

Region 与 Endpoint

  • Endpoint 是服务入口地址,多数厂商由 region 派生(如 OSS https://oss-cn-hangzhou.aliyuncs.com)或由账号 ID 派生(如 R2 https://<ACCOUNT_ID>.r2.cloudflarestorage.com
  • region 是否必需、如何派生,各厂商不同(详见 供应商对比

概念关系总览:一个 Bucket 容纳若干对象,对象通过 Key 定位;带 / 的 前缀看起来像"目录",实际上是 Key 的命名约定。

各厂商 SDK 对照:S3 系(R2 / MinIO / AWS)用 @aws-sdk/client-s3ListBuckets / HeadBucket / CreateBucket / ListObjectsV2 / PutObject / GetObject / DeleteObject / DeleteBucket 命令;OSS 用 ali-osslistBuckets / list / put / get / delete;Supabase 用 @supabase/supabase-jsstorage.listBuckets() / getBucket() / createBucket() / from(bucket).list() / upload() / download() / remove()

典型操作流程(与各原型 demo 的执行顺序一致):

1. 列出 Bucket

// S3 系(@aws-sdk/client-s3)
const { Buckets } = await client.send(new ListBucketsCommand({}));
  • 该操作需要"列出所有桶"的权限 —— R2 的 API Token 需 Admin Read & Write, Object 级 Token 会 403(见 供应商对比
  • OSS 的 listBuckets 需传 {}(传 null 会崩,SDK 实现细节)

2. 确保 Bucket 存在(不存在则创建)

通用模式:先探测(HeadBucket / getBucket),404 表示不存在 → 创建。

// S3 系:HeadBucket 404 则 CreateBucket
try {
  await client.send(new HeadBucketCommand({ Bucket }));
  // 已存在,直接使用
} catch (err) {
  if (is404(err)) await client.send(new CreateBucketCommand({ Bucket }));
}
  • 创建后 bucket 默认私有,即可直接使用
  • 探测失败要区分 404(真的不存在) 与其他错误(网络 / 鉴权)—— 后者 不能当"不存在"处理,否则会掩盖真实故障

3. 列出对象(按前缀)

// S3 系
const { Contents } = await client.send(
  new ListObjectsV2Command({ Bucket, Prefix: "demo/", MaxKeys: 20 }),
);
  • Prefix 用于过滤"目录";MaxKeys / limit 控制数量
  • 结果可能分页:S3 的 NextContinuationToken、OSS 的 nextMarker
  • 列表返回对象的 key 与大小(size),可用来实现"目录浏览"

4. 上传(Put)

// S3 系
await client.send(new PutObjectCommand({
  Bucket, Key, Body: Buffer.from(content), ContentType: "text/plain",
}));
  • 同 key 重复上传 = 覆盖(S3 系无版本控制时);Supabase 需 upsert: true 才能覆盖,否则报 Duplicate
  • 建议显式设置 Content-Type,否则对象可能被存为默认类型

5. 下载(Get)

// S3 系
const { Body } = await client.send(new GetObjectCommand({ Bucket, Key }));
const text = await Body.transformToString();
  • 小对象可直接读入内存;大对象应流式读取

6. 签名 URL(限时下载 / 客户端直传)

  • 下载 URL(GET):getSignedUrl(client, new GetObjectCommand({...}), { expiresIn: 60 })
  • 上传 URL(PUT):同上但用 PutObjectCommand
  • 用途:前端直传 / 直下,数据不经过后端;原理与坑见 签名 URL(Signed URL)

7. 删除

await client.send(new DeleteObjectCommand({ Bucket, Key }));  // 删对象
await client.send(new DeleteBucketCommand({ Bucket }));       // 删桶(须为空)
  • 删除是幂等的:删不存在的 key 也成功(S3 系;OSS 也返回 204)
  • 非空桶删除失败:先删对象再删桶;清理逻辑应 best-effort(失败报告但不致命)
  • 清理原则:只删自己创建的资源 —— 预先存在的 bucket 只写自己的前缀, 运行结束后不删除该桶

通用机制与约定

  • 前缀即目录:用带 / 结尾的前缀组织对象(如 demo/r2-client/);列对象 + 前缀过滤 = 目录浏览;"删除目录" = 删该前缀下所有对象
  • 默认私有:bucket 默认不可匿名访问;公开访问要么设公开桶,要么用签名 URL
  • 凭证不进代码:凭据放环境变量(.env),git-ignore 掉 .env*,只提交 .env.example 模板
  • 浏览器直传需要 CORS:浏览器端直传 / 直读签名 URL 时,还要给 bucket 配置 CORS(允许的来源、方法、响应头)—— 这是独立于签名本身的配置
  • SDK 公共配置项(S3 系常见):
  • endpoint:可覆盖为本地测试服务(如 MinIO)
  • forcePathStyle:本地 MinIO 需要(localhost 无虚拟主机 DNS),真实云服务不需要
  • region:R2 忽略(用 auto)、MinIO 要 us-east-1
  • checksum 开关:新版 SDK 默认给 PutObject 加 CRC32 头,设 requestChecksumCalculation: "WHEN_REQUIRED" 可保持上传纯净、兼容所有 S3 兼容端点
